Overhaul defence procurement system, govt urged amid army probe

Cover Image for Overhaul defence procurement system, govt urged amid army probe

Malaysia Corruption Watch says confidentiality must not be used as justification to conceal missteps in financial governance or abuse of power.

PETALING JAYA: An anti-graft group has urged Putrajaya to overhaul its defence procurement system amid a corruption investigation into military procurement contracts allegedly involving a top army officer.

Malaysia Corruption Watch (MCW) said the investigation had exposed systemic flaws in governance for defence procurements, adding that the focus should not be merely on the prominent individual implicated.

MCW president Jais Abdul Karim said the uncovering of alleged corruption in high-value military contracts raised questions about the effectiveness of control mechanisms for defence procurements.
